# Prompt the user for input
num1 = int(input("Enter first number: "))
num2 = int(input("Enter second number: "))
operator = input("Enter operator (+, -, *, /): ")
# Perform calculation
if operator == '+':
result = num1 + num2
elif operator == '-':
result = num1 - num2
elif operator == '*':
result = num1 * num2
elif operator == '/':
'''
if num2 != 0:
result = num1 / num2
else:
result = "Error: Cannot divide by zero"
'''
try:
result = num1 / num2
except ZeroDivisionError:
result = "Error: Cannot divide by zero"
else:
result = "Invalid operator"
# Print the result
print("Result:", result)
